Previous Daily Devotional About when God says "No" and we must trust Him Psalm 31:15 My times are in your hands; deliver me from my enemies and from those who pursue me. 16 Let your face shine on your servant; save me in your unfailing love. (NIV) God has plans and purposes for your life. God's plans and purposes for your life may not be your plans and your purposes. You may not always know with certainty what God wants for you and from you. You may go to God in prayer and beg and plead for answers that never come or when the answers come, God says "No." When we receive God's "No" answer, we must then put our life into His hands and remember He loves us beyond measure. When we receive God's "No" answer, we must remember His plans and His purposes are more important than our own. For if we demand our own way that is not His way, then His plans and purposes for our life might not be fulfilled. Living fruitfully and fully with God's "No" answers and our willingness to be humble, enables us to do God's will, enables us to fit into His plans, and enables us to fulfill His purposes. We may not like His answers. We may not like His plans for we may have plans that are more pleasing to us. We may not like His purposes for us for we may have our own purposes. However, if we want His peace, His love, and His compassion then we must accept His answers, whether we like His answers or not. |
